  9. I think rockets are intended to be a niche item, they can help in min-maxing a ship build, I think people just don't know how or when to use them properly. They are an adjunct, not primary propulsion. I don't think comparing to XL space engine makes much sense, when rockets also work in atmo and are not a substitute for space propulsion. I use rockets on cargo ships for emergency power (it has saved me from crashing a couple times), and aiding atmo to space transition with a heavy load. I don't add more atmo engines or airfoils because that would add mass and make my ship less efficient for the rest of the 95% of the time I am flying the ship. When I do fire my rocket to get out of atmo I only need to use 5-10% of the fuel tank capacity, depending on how overweight my ship is. And the rocket talents do make a difference when you combine them. I have a 250t M core ship with 1 medium rocket engine, 1 large space engine and 2 large atmo engines, I recently used it to get off Thades with 900t additional cargo. I burned maybe 30,000 quanta worth of rocket fuel at market prices, or 10,000 ore value plus labor of crafting my own. Seemed worth it to me.
